One of the key advantages of biopharmaceuticals is their ability to target specific disease pathways with high precision. Unlike traditional chemical drugs, which are often broad-spectrum in nature, biopharmaceuticals are designed to interact with specific proteins or molecules in the body that are involved in disease processes. This targeted approach can lead to more effective treatments with fewer side effects, making biopharmaceuticals a preferred option for many patients and healthcare providers.
biopharmaceutical manufacturers use cutting-edge technologies and techniques to produce these specialized medications. Many biopharmaceuticals are made using biotechnology processes, such as recombinant DNA technology, where genes are inserted into cells to produce therapeutic proteins. This allows for the production of complex molecules that would be difficult or impossible to synthesize through chemical means alone.
In addition to developing new therapies, biopharmaceutical manufacturers also play a critical role in ensuring that these medications are safe, effective, and of high quality. This involves rigorous testing and evaluation at every stage of the drug development process, from initial research to clinical trials to final production. Regulatory authorities, such as the FDA in the United States, closely monitor and regulate the activities of biopharmaceutical manufacturers to ensure that their products meet the highest standards of safety and efficacy.
Once a biopharmaceutical has been approved for use, manufacturers must scale up production to meet the demand of patients and healthcare providers. This often involves building or expanding manufacturing facilities, implementing quality control systems, and collaborating with supply chain partners to ensure reliable and efficient distribution of medications. biopharmaceutical manufacturers must also stay up-to-date on the latest advances in technology and research in order to continue developing new and improved therapies.
